Starting in Kochi: A Cultural Kaleidoscope
Your adventure begins with an easy transfer from Kochi airport, giving you some time to settle into your hotel and get a first taste of the city. The next day is dedicated to exploring Fort Kochi, a district famous for its colonial architecture, vibrant markets, and historic sites like St. Francis Church and the Jewish Synagogue. The visit to Mattancherry Palace (also known as the Dutch Palace) offers a glimpse into Kerala’s regal past.
As evening falls, you’ll experience a Kathakali dance performance—an immersive introduction to India’s classical dance-drama. Reviewers mention that guides are quite engaging, often explaining the stories behind the lavish costumes and intricate makeup, which significantly enriches the show.
Moving to the Hill Stations: Munnar’s Tea Gardens and Waterfalls
Next, the journey takes you into the lush hills of Munnar, a highlight for nature lovers. The drive offers stunning views of waterfalls, rolling hills, and misty clouds—a visual feast that reviewers describe as “marvelous.” The visit to Eravikulam National Park is particularly noteworthy; known for its population of Nilgiri Tahr, it’s a must for wildlife enthusiasts.
You’ll also explore the Mattupetty Dam and walk through the old Munnar town and market, experiencing local life and picking up souvenirs. Reviewers have appreciated the chance to stroll through tea estates, with some describing it as a peaceful, almost meditative activity.
Wildlife and Spice Plantations at Periyar
From Munnar, the tour heads to Periyar, home to one of India’s largest wildlife sanctuaries. Here, you’ll enjoy a boat ride on Lake Periyar, where elephants and other animals may be spotted grazing near the water. Bamboo rafting and border hiking are unique activities at Periyar, highly praised for their authenticity and adventure factor.
Reviews highlight the knowledgeable guides who often share fascinating stories about the flora and fauna, adding depth to the experience. The sanctuary’s size (covering 777 sq km) guarantees a good chance of seeing wildlife, and the nearby temples, like Kumily, Mangala, and Devi Temple, add cultural flavor.
Backwaters and Cultural Charm in Kumarakom & Alappuzha
Moving further south, you’ll visit Kumarakom, a serene village famed for its bird sanctuary. The afternoon features a backwater cruise in a traditional shikara boat, passing narrow canals dotted with floating houses and loads of coir and cashew boats. Reviewers enjoy the intimate feel of this cruise, describing it as a peaceful, picturesque experience.
The highlight here is the houseboat stay in Alappuzha, an iconic Kerala experience. The boat gently glides through lagoons, passing lush rice paddies and local villages. Lunch and dinner are served onboard, giving you a taste of authentic Kerala cuisine, and reviewers note that the local street walk in Alappuzha is a charming way to soak in local life.
